I do not use a separate Equalizer. All digital preamp processors have EQ capability of one sort or another. The ones I have used and use currently have EQ in several different forms. The first is your typical parametric EQ but with frequency and Q selection and the second is via Target curves. Parametric EQ can be done on the fly whereas Target curves are designed to address specific problems. As an example some recordings might have a tendency towards sibilance. So I programmed a target curve with a Gundry dip in it. I have a base target curve that tells the system how I want it to sound from an amplitude perspective.
Preamp processors available now are the MiniDSP SHD, The Anthem STR, the DEQX Pre4 and 8, and the Trinnov Amethyst. They range in price from $1500 to $13,000.
